PANJIM: Goa is likely to receive light to moderate rain/ thundershowers in some parts in the next four days. However, the Indian Meteorological Department (IMD) on Sunday recorded temperatures of 32 degrees Celsius.
“Light to moderate rain /thundershower is very likely to occur at many places over Goa state during next five days,” the IMD weather forecast states.
The IMD weather forecast further reads that “Sankhali & Canacona recorded 1 cm rain. There was no large change in maximum temperature in Goa State. They were below normal in South Goa district and normal in North Goa district. The highest maximum temperature of 32 oC was recorded at Panjim and Mormugao.”
